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8496 4380854284 8905226346 69573503 6077
2638406339 16689344032 20927887197
2638406339 16689344032 20927887197
67 310642110 0789466
All about undefined
Interested in learning more?
2638406339 16689344032 20927887197
67 310642110 0789466
See more
67 2876
827 72142616 458277 1333525378 5853995603
See more
04947127 6348144 01
264860 3190 48817842
See more